Abstract
The beginning of the new century took us into an entirely new epoch which, unfortunately, still have unresolved situation of the previous century. One of the attempts to resolve these drawbacks can be seen in the historical and political fact of the establishment of the European Union.
At the same time, the establishment of EU requires a very constructive and pluriperspective analyze of the (political) identity of the Union, its moral and ethical justification base, especially through the media and their space. It is about pluriperspective moral justification of the applicability of the ethical value system that is offered by the new European identity that is trying to impost, through the media reality, the media as the (communicative) place for exchanging the knowledge of society itself.
Hence, this paper deals with analysis of ethical value and viability of this new identity, moral values carry with it and offered by the same, the role of media in creating and transferring this image, because they are a major engine of shaping and reshaping the world, the life…, and the importance of journalism in the process of educating the public regarding European ethical values, because common knowledge is that public constitutes communicational, social, political and general value space, necessary for an individual life orientation of people, as well as for the collective shaping of the social and political will.
